Leandro Trossard’s Belgium side once again failed to get a win at the World Cup as a resolute Iranian side held them in Los Angeles.

A packed out and impressive SoFi Stadium witnessed what was a drab 0-0 draw in the end as the out of sorts Belgians once again underperformed on the biggest stage.

For Arsenal fans, it was a chance to see their winger Leandro Trossard in action as he played the whole 90 minutes.

And in fairness to Trossard, he was Belgium’s best player.

He created five big chances throughout the game and was a constant menace down the left-hand side.

Indeed, so impressive was his performance, that Arsenal fans were all suggesting that it was the rest of the team that let him down.
